Describe the effect of aging on the special sense organs.

Verified step by step guidance
1
Step 1: Identify the special sense organs involved, which include the eyes (vision), ears (hearing and balance), tongue (taste), nose (smell), and skin (touch).
Step 2: Explain how aging affects the eyes, such as decreased lens elasticity leading to presbyopia, reduced pupil size affecting light intake, and possible degeneration of the retina impacting vision clarity.
Step 3: Describe the impact of aging on the ears, including the loss of hair cells in the cochlea causing presbycusis (age-related hearing loss) and changes in the vestibular system that may affect balance.
Step 4: Discuss changes in the tongue and nose, such as a reduction in the number and sensitivity of taste buds and olfactory receptors, leading to diminished taste and smell sensations.
Step 5: Mention the decline in tactile sensitivity due to reduced receptor density and slower nerve conduction, which affects the sense of touch in aging individuals.

Aging and Sensory Decline

Aging leads to gradual deterioration in the function of special sense organs, causing reduced sensitivity and slower response times. This decline affects vision, hearing, taste, smell, and balance, impacting daily activities and quality of life.

Structural Changes in Special Sense Organs

With age, structural changes occur in organs like the eyes (e.g., lens stiffening), ears (e.g., hair cell loss), and olfactory epithelium (e.g., receptor cell reduction). These changes impair the organs' ability to detect and transmit sensory information accurately.

Functional Consequences of Sensory Aging

The functional impact includes presbyopia (difficulty focusing on close objects), presbycusis (age-related hearing loss), diminished taste and smell sensitivity, and balance issues. These effects can lead to safety risks and decreased social interaction.
